Spatial Concept

Verdant Vanguard is an agricultural research facility that mirrors the enduring spirit of nature. It is a testament to growth, renewal, and the seamless integration of human ingenuity with the natural environment.

The facility is designed as a series of interconnected structures that take inspiration from the organic forms of trees and forests. The main building rises like a tree canopy, with branching structures that support research labs, educational spaces, and public areas. These ‘branches’ extend outward, blending into the landscape and creating a symbiotic relationship between the built environment and the surrounding ecosystem.

Project

Verdant Vanguard is designed to be inherently adaptable, with modular labs and flexible workspaces that can evolve with the changing needs of research and technology. The use of responsive materials and smart building systems allows the facility to adjust to environmental conditions, much like how plants adapt to their surroundings.

The facility is not just a place for research but also a hub for community engagement and education. Public gardens, interactive exhibits, and workshop spaces invite the community to learn about sustainable agriculture and the importance of preserving our natural world.
